Strong to severe storms possible Sunday before temperature plunge

ATLANTA — A strong storm system will move into north Georgia late Sunday and Monday ahead of a cold front.

“Areas of heavy rain, damaging wind gusts and brief spin up tornado possible,” Severe Weather Team 2 Meteorologist Eboni Deon said.

As the system moves out, much colder temperatures will move in. Snow is possible Monday over parts of north Georgia.

What you need to know

  • Strong storms move in late Sunday
  • Temperatures will fall to the 20s and 30s Monday
  • Light snow accumulations are possible in north Georgia Monday afternoon
